Share via


Management Groups - Create Or Update

建立或更新管理群組。 如果已建立管理群組,且後續的建立要求會以不同的屬性發出,則會更新管理群組屬性。

PUT https://management.azure.com/providers/Microsoft.Management/managementGroups/{groupId}?api-version=2020-05-01

URI 參數

名稱 位於 必要 類型 Description
groupId
path True

string

管理群組標識碼。

api-version
query True

string

要與用戶端要求搭配使用的 API 版本。 目前的版本為 2018-01-01-preview。

要求標頭

名稱 必要 類型 Description
Cache-Control

string

表示要求不應使用任何快取。

要求本文

名稱 類型 Description
name

string

管理群組的名稱。 例如,00000000-0000-0000-0000-0000000000000

properties.details

CreateManagementGroupDetails

詳細資料
建立期間使用之管理群組的詳細數據。

properties.displayName

string

管理群組的易記名稱。 如果未傳遞任何值,此字段將會設定為 groupId。

回應

名稱 類型 Description
200 OK

ManagementGroup

確定

202 Accepted

AzureAsyncOperationResults

已接受

Headers

  • Location: string
  • Azure-AsyncOperation: string
Other Status Codes

ErrorResponse

錯誤

安全性

azure_auth

Azure Active Directory OAuth2 Flow。

Type: oauth2
Flow: implicit
Authorization URL: https://login.microsoftonline.com/common/oauth2/authorize

Scopes

名稱 Description
user_impersonation 模擬您的用戶帳戶

範例

PutManagementGroup

Sample Request

PUT https://management.azure.com/providers/Microsoft.Management/managementGroups/ChildGroup?api-version=2020-05-01


{
  "properties": {
    "displayName": "ChildGroup",
    "details": {
      "parent": {
        "id": "/providers/Microsoft.Management/managementGroups/RootGroup"
      }
    }
  }
}

Sample Response

{
  "id": "/providers/Microsoft.Management/managementGroups/ChildGroup",
  "type": "Microsoft.Management/managementGroups",
  "name": "ChildGroup",
  "properties": {
    "tenantId": "20000000-0000-0000-0000-000000000000",
    "displayName": "ChildGroup",
    "details": {
      "version": 1,
      "updatedTime": "2018-01-01T00:00:00.00Z",
      "updatedBy": "16b8ef21-5c9f-420c-bcc9-e4f8c9f30b4b",
      "parent": {
        "id": "/providers/Microsoft.Management/managementGroups/RootGroup",
        "name": "RootGroup",
        "displayName": "RootGroup"
      }
    }
  }
}
{
  "id": "/providers/Microsoft.Management/managementGroups/ChildGroup",
  "type": "Microsoft.Management/managementGroups",
  "name": "ChildGroup",
  "status": "NotStarted"
}

定義

名稱 Description
AzureAsyncOperationResults

Azure-AsyncOperation 的結果。

CreateManagementGroupChildInfo

建立期間所使用之管理群組的子資訊。

CreateManagementGroupDetails

建立期間使用之管理群組的詳細數據。

CreateManagementGroupRequest

管理群組建立參數。

CreateParentGroupInfo

(選擇性) 建立期間使用的父管理群組標識碼。

ErrorDetails

錯誤的詳細數據。

ErrorResponse

錯誤物件。

ManagementGroup

管理群組詳細數據。

ManagementGroupChildInfo

管理群組的子資訊。

ManagementGroupChildType

子資源的型別。

ManagementGroupDetails

管理群組的詳細數據。

ManagementGroupPathElement

管理群組上階的路徑專案。

ParentGroupInfo

(選擇性) 父管理群組的標識碼。

AzureAsyncOperationResults

Azure-AsyncOperation 的結果。

名稱 類型 Description
id

string

管理群組的完整標識碼。 例如,/providers/Microsoft.Management/managementGroups/0000000-0000-0000-0000-00000000000000

name

string

管理群組的名稱。 例如,00000000-0000-0000-0000-0000000000000

properties.displayName

string

管理群組的易記名稱。

properties.tenantId

string

與管理群組相關聯的 AAD 租用戶標識碼。 例如,00000000-0000-0000-0000-0000000000000

status

string

執行之異步操作的目前狀態。 例如,執行中、成功、失敗

type

string

資源類型。 例如,Microsoft.Management/managementGroups

CreateManagementGroupChildInfo

建立期間所使用之管理群組的子資訊。

名稱 類型 Description
children

CreateManagementGroupChildInfo[]

子系列表。

displayName

string

子資源的易記名稱。

id

string

子資源 (管理群組或訂用帳戶) 的完整標識符。 例如,/providers/Microsoft.Management/managementGroups/0000000-0000-0000-0000-00000000000000

name

string

子實體的名稱。

type

ManagementGroupChildType

子資源的型別。
包含提供者命名空間的完整資源類型 (,例如 Microsoft.Management/managementGroups)

CreateManagementGroupDetails

建立期間使用之管理群組的詳細數據。

名稱 類型 Description
parent

CreateParentGroupInfo

Parent
(選擇性) 建立期間使用的父管理群組標識碼。

updatedBy

string

更新物件之主體或進程的識別。

updatedTime

string

上次更新此物件的日期和時間。

version

number

物件的版本號碼。

CreateManagementGroupRequest

管理群組建立參數。

名稱 類型 Description
id

string

管理群組的完整標識碼。 例如,/providers/Microsoft.Management/managementGroups/0000000-0000-0000-0000-00000000000000

name

string

管理群組的名稱。 例如,00000000-0000-0000-0000-0000000000000

properties.children

CreateManagementGroupChildInfo[]

子系列表。

properties.details

CreateManagementGroupDetails

詳細資料
建立期間使用之管理群組的詳細數據。

properties.displayName

string

管理群組的易記名稱。 如果未傳遞任何值,此字段將會設定為 groupId。

properties.tenantId

string

與管理群組相關聯的 AAD 租用戶標識碼。 例如,00000000-0000-0000-0000-0000000000000

type

string

資源類型。 例如,Microsoft.Management/managementGroups

CreateParentGroupInfo

(選擇性) 建立期間使用的父管理群組標識碼。

名稱 類型 Description
displayName

string

父管理群組的易記名稱。

id

string

父管理群組的完整標識碼。 例如,/providers/Microsoft.Management/managementGroups/0000000-0000-0000-0000-00000000000000

name

string

父管理群組的名稱

ErrorDetails

錯誤的詳細數據。

名稱 類型 Description
code

string

其中一組伺服器定義的錯誤碼。

details

string

人類看得懂的錯誤詳細數據表示法。

message

string

人類看得懂的錯誤表示法。

ErrorResponse

錯誤物件。

名稱 類型 Description
error

ErrorDetails

錯誤
錯誤的詳細數據。

ManagementGroup

管理群組詳細數據。

名稱 類型 Description
id

string

管理群組的完整標識碼。 例如,/providers/Microsoft.Management/managementGroups/0000000-0000-0000-0000-00000000000000

name

string

管理群組的名稱。 例如,00000000-0000-0000-0000-0000000000000

properties.children

ManagementGroupChildInfo[]

子系列表。

properties.details

ManagementGroupDetails

詳細資料
管理群組的詳細數據。

properties.displayName

string

管理群組的易記名稱。

properties.tenantId

string

與管理群組相關聯的 AAD 租用戶標識碼。 例如,00000000-0000-0000-0000-0000000000000

type

string

資源類型。 例如,Microsoft.Management/managementGroups

ManagementGroupChildInfo

管理群組的子資訊。

名稱 類型 Description
children

ManagementGroupChildInfo[]

子系列表。

displayName

string

子資源的易記名稱。

id

string

子資源 (管理群組或訂用帳戶) 的完整標識符。 例如,/providers/Microsoft.Management/managementGroups/0000000-0000-0000-0000-00000000000000

name

string

子實體的名稱。

type

ManagementGroupChildType

子資源的型別。
包含提供者命名空間的完整資源類型 (,例如 Microsoft.Management/managementGroups)

ManagementGroupChildType

子資源的型別。

名稱 類型 Description
/subscriptions

string

Microsoft.Management/managementGroups

string

ManagementGroupDetails

管理群組的詳細數據。

名稱 類型 Description
parent

ParentGroupInfo

Parent
(選擇性) 父管理群組的標識碼。

path

ManagementGroupPathElement[]

從根目錄到目前群組的路徑。

updatedBy

string

更新物件之主體或進程的識別。

updatedTime

string

上次更新此物件的日期和時間。

version

number

物件的版本號碼。

ManagementGroupPathElement

管理群組上階的路徑專案。

名稱 類型 Description
displayName

string

群組的易記名稱。

name

string

群組的名稱。

ParentGroupInfo

(選擇性) 父管理群組的標識碼。

名稱 類型 Description
displayName

string

父管理群組的易記名稱。

id

string

父管理群組的完整標識碼。 例如,/providers/Microsoft.Management/managementGroups/0000000-0000-0000-0000-00000000000000

name

string

父管理群組的名稱